What are Magnetic Bead Microbial DNA/RNA Co-Extraction Kits?

 

Magnetic bead microbial DNA/RNA co-extraction kits purify both genomic DNA and total RNA, including small RNAs >=17 nt, from microbial community samples - stool, soil, water, biofilm, swabs, and body fluids using BashingBead mechanical lysis in a 96-deep-well plate followed by binding of nucleic acids to paramagnetic silica-coated beads, magnetic separation during successive wash steps to remove PCR inhibitors, and elution in >=50 ul of ZymoBIOMICS DNase/RNase-Free Water. The entire purification phase requires no centrifugation and integrates directly with KingFisher Flex, Accuris IsoPure 96, and AllSheng AutoPure 96 liquid-handling platforms. Choose the magnetic bead format for microbial DNA/RNA co-extraction when processing 48+ community samples per session, when a compatible automation platform is available, or when reproducibility across hundreds of samples is required for a human microbiome cohort, environmental monitoring, or clinical trial.

How to Choose a Magnetic Bead Microbial DNA/RNA Co-Extraction Kit

 

Automation Script Availability

Confirm the kit manufacturer provides a validated, instrument-specific script for your platform before purchase. Zymo Research provides automation scripts for KingFisher Flex, KingFisher Apex, Accuris IsoPure 96, and AllSheng AutoPure 96; Tecan Fluent and Hamilton STAR scripts require adaptation. Script development and validation add 2-4 weeks; factor this into project timelines.

Combined vs. Separate Analyte Fractions

The ZymoBIOMICS MagBead DNA/RNA kit elutes a combined total nucleic acid fraction. For studies requiring separate DNA and RNA fractions from the same extraction (parallel metagenomics and metatranscriptomics), apply post-extraction enzymatic depletion (DNase I on the RNA aliquot, RNase A on the DNA aliquot) or use the ZymoBIOMICS DNA/RNA Miniprep kit, which uses column-switching architecture for native separation.

96-Well Bead-Beating Setup

The lysis step requires a 96-well bead mill compatible with ZR-96 BashingBead Lysis Racks. Validated instruments include GenoGrinder 2000, Retsch MM400 with a 96-tube rack adapter, and Bertin Precellys. The bead-beating step is the primary manual step in an otherwise automated workflow; confirm the lab has a compatible bead mill before adopting the kit.

Inhibitor Load by Sample Type

Stool samples have moderate inhibitor loads (bile salts, starch metabolites) that ZymoBIOMICS wash steps reliably remove. Soil samples -- especially high-humic tropical or peat soils - carry heavier inhibitor loads that may require reducing input mass to 10-50 mg per well and validating A260/A230 >= 1.5 on initial test extractions. If A260/A230 remains below 1.5, apply an additional cleanup step with Zymo OneStep PCR Inhibitor Removal Columns before library preparation.

DNA/RNA Shield Sample Collection

For multi-site human microbiome cohort studies, use DNA/RNA Shield fecal collection tubes (Zymo R1101) as the collection device. Samples stabilized at room temperature for up to 30 days in Shield are directly loadable into the ZR-96 BashingBead Rack, streamlining the pre-extraction workflow and enabling consistent RNA preservation across diverse collection sites.

 

Specifications Context

 

ZymoBIOMICS MagBead DNA/RNA kit produces total nucleic acid eluted into >=50 ul with A260/A280 >= 1.8, A260/A230 >= 1.5, and DNA fragment sizes suitable for 16S rRNA amplicon sequencing and shotgun metagenomics. Input specification: approximately 2 × 10^8 bacterial cells, 2 × 10^7 yeast cells, or ~40 mg human stool per well. A published 2024 high-throughput fecal microbiome DNA extraction study demonstrated that bead-beating at >=3,000xg significantly improves detection of hard-to-lyse Gram-positive genera - Blautia, Bifidobacterium, and Ruminococcus compared with no bead-beating, confirming that mechanical lysis is non-negotiable for unbiased community co-extraction. Magnetic bead microbial DNA/RNA co-extraction kits purify both genomic DNA and total RNA from microbial community samples — stool, soil, water, biofilm, swabs, and body fluids — using bead-beating lysis followed by binding of nucleic acids to paramagnetic silica-coated beads, magnetic separation during wash steps to remove inhibitors, and elution in separate DNA and RNA fractions in 96-well format on liquid-handling automation platforms, without centrifugation for the purification phase.
The ZymoBIOMICS MagBead DNA/RNA kit is validated for KingFisher Flex, KingFisher Apex, Accuris IsoPure 96, and AllSheng AutoPure 96, with instrument-specific automation scripts provided by Zymo Research. For Tecan Fluent and Hamilton STAR integration, Zymo Research's automation support team provides script adaptation and validation assistance. The ZymoBIOMICS MagBead DNA/RNA kit processes approximately 10–250 mg of feces or 50–250 mg of soil per well in a 96-deep-well plate, with a recommended input of ~40 mg of stool per well for standard gut microbiome studies. Scaling input proportionally up or down adjusts bead volume and buffer volumes accordingly. For low-biomass samples (expected DNA yield <50 ng), reduce input and increase elution concentration or pool post-extraction replicates before library preparation.
Yes. The ZymoBIOMICS MagBead DNA/RNA kit delivers nucleic acids as a combined total nucleic acid eluate in ≥50 µl of ZymoBIOMICS DNase/RNase-Free Water. For workflows requiring separate DNA and RNA fractions — such as parallel 16S amplicon sequencing (DNA) and rRNA-depleted metatranscriptomics (RNA) — apply DNase I treatment to the RNA fraction post-extraction and RNase A treatment to the DNA fraction post-extraction, or use the ZymoBIOMICS DNA/RNA Miniprep Kit which delivers separate fractions by column-switching design.
For 96-well microbial co-extraction, samples are added to individual wells of a ZR-96 BashingBead Lysis Rack containing 0.1 mm and 0.5 mm beads, capped, and homogenized at ≥3,000×g for 5 minutes in a 96-well bead mill (e.g., GenoGrinder, Retsch MM400 with 96-tube adapter, or Bertin Precellys). After bead beating, the rack is centrifuged at ≥3,000×g for 5 minutes to clarify the lysate, and the supernatant is transferred to the magnetic bead extraction plate for purification.
Yes. The ZymoBIOMICS MagBead kit includes wash buffers that remove co-purified PCR inhibitors — including humic acids from soil and bile salts from stool — during the magnetic bead washing steps. The purified DNA and RNA eluates are inhibitor-free and ready for qPCR, 16S rRNA amplicon sequencing, and NGS library preparation without additional cleanup. A260/A230 ≥ 1.5 in the eluate confirms effective inhibitor removal.
The ZymoBIOMICS MagBead DNA/RNA kit processes 96 samples in approximately 3–4 hours including bead-beating lysis (manual or automated), magnetic bead purification on an automated platform, and elution. On a KingFisher Flex instrument, the magnetic bead purification phase alone takes 45–60 minutes for a full 96-well plate. For studies processing 500+ samples per week — typical of large human microbiome cohorts — two instruments running parallel batches can process 192 samples per 4-hour run, enabling a weekly throughput of 960 samples with a single instrument team.
Run the ZymoBIOMICS Microbial Community DNA Standard (D6300) for DNA fraction validation and ZymoBIOMICS Microbial Community RNA Standard for RNA fraction validation in every extraction batch. Acceptable DNA performance: recovery of all 8 community members (Listeria, Pseudomonas, Bacillus, Enterococcus, E. coli, Salmonella, Saccharomyces, Cryptococcus) at expected relative abundances by 16S/ITS amplicon sequencing. Acceptable RNA performance: Ct within 2 cycles of reference extraction, A260/A230 ≥ 1.5, and RIN ≥ 5.
